Perfecting Your Stance to Aim Dart Accurately

Your stance forms the foundation of your dart throw. A stable and balanced stance allows for consistent delivery, crucial for pinpoint accuracy. There are several stance variations, but the most common are the side-on, open, and closed stances. The best dart stance is the one that feels most comfortable and natural for you, allowing for a smooth and repeatable motion.

  • Side-On Stance: Position your body perpendicular to the dartboard, with your throwing shoulder pointing directly at the target.
  • Open Stance: A slightly angled stance, providing a clearer view of the board.
  • Closed Stance: Similar to the side-on, but with your front foot slightly closer to the oche (the throwing line).

Experiment with each stance to find the one that feels most stable and allows you to maintain a consistent throwing motion. Make sure your weight is evenly distributed and that you feel balanced. It’s also crucial to keep your head still throughout the throw; any unnecessary movement can disrupt your aim dart process. Remember to practice regularly to solidify your stance and make it second nature.

The Grip: Your Connection to Accurate Dart Throws

The grip is another fundamental aspect of aim dart. A proper grip provides control and consistency, directly influencing your throw’s trajectory. Finding the best dart grip is a personal journey, but understanding the principles of a good grip can help guide you. Avoid gripping the dart too tightly, which can lead to tension and inaccuracy. Instead, aim for a relaxed but firm grip.

Types of Grips

  • Two-Finger Grip: A minimalist grip, offering less control but potentially more feel.
  • Three-Finger Grip: A common grip, providing a balance between control and feel.
  • Four-Finger Grip: Offers maximum control but can feel less natural for some players.

Experiment with different grip styles and pressures. The key is to find a grip that allows you to release the dart smoothly and consistently, without gripping so hard that your hand shakes or tenses up. The Throw: Releasing with Precision to Aim Dart Effectively

The throw is the culmination of all your preparation. A smooth, controlled throwing motion is essential for accuracy. Focus on maintaining a consistent arm angle and release point. Avoid jerking or rushing your throw. Instead, aim for a fluid motion that starts from your stance and flows through your release. Think of it as a pendulum swinging smoothly from your shoulder.

Key Elements of a Consistent Throw

  • Backswing: Draw the dart back smoothly, keeping your elbow high.
  • Forward Swing: Move your arm forward in a straight line, aiming for your target.
  • Release Point: Release the dart just before your arm reaches full extension.
  • Follow Through: Continue your arm motion after releasing the dart, pointing towards your target.

Practice your throw regularly, focusing on consistency and control. Pay attention to your arm angle, release point, and follow-through. Consider filming yourself throwing to identify any areas for improvement. Remember, consistency is key when learning how to aim dart. Mental Game: Focus and Concentration to Aim Dart with Precision

The mental aspect of darts is often overlooked, but it’s just as important as the physical skills. Maintaining focus and concentration can be the difference between hitting your target and missing it completely. Learn to manage your emotions and avoid getting frustrated when you miss. Every dart player misses, even the professionals. The key is to learn from your mistakes and stay positive.

Strategies for Mental Toughness

  • Visualization: Imagine yourself hitting your target before each throw.
  • Positive Self-Talk: Encourage yourself and avoid negative thoughts.
  • Deep Breathing: Take deep breaths to calm your nerves and improve focus.
  • Routine: Develop a pre-throw routine to help you focus and prepare.

Practice mental exercises to improve your focus and concentration. Meditation, mindfulness, and visualization techniques can all be helpful. Remember, darts is a game of precision and patience. Practice Drills: Sharpening Your Aim Dart Skills

Consistent practice is essential for improving your dart skills. However, simply throwing darts randomly is not the most effective way to improve. Implementing specific practice drills can help you target your weaknesses and sharpen your strengths. Choose drills that challenge you and focus on areas where you need the most improvement.

Effective Practice Drills

  • Around the Clock: Start at 1 and work your way around the board, hitting each number in sequence.
  • Shanghai: Aim for the single, double, and treble of a specific number in one round.
  • Checkout Practice: Practice finishing specific checkout combinations.
  • High Score Challenge: See how many points you can score in a set number of rounds.

Make your practice sessions challenging and engaging. Keep track of your progress and celebrate your improvements. The more you practice, the more consistent you’ll become, and the better you’ll be able to aim dart with precision.
